Nick Park, a rising star in the field hockey world, is on a mission to inspire more kids from state schools to dream of competing at the Olympics. At just 25 years old, Park is one of seven debutants in a 16-member men’s squad set to take on Paris 2024. Unlike many of his peers, Park’s journey to the sport was unconventional, having had little exposure to hockey while growing up in Caversham Park. Raised on a diet of football, rugby, and cricket, Park stumbled upon field hockey almost by accident when his sister attended a hockey trial.
Reflecting on his early days in the sport, Park shared, “I was just a kid who loved all sports. I had absolutely no idea about hockey, it wasn’t massive in my friendship groups.” The lack of access to hockey at Highdown School, where Park was a student, due to the absence of an astroturf pitch meant that he discovered the sport through serendipity. Despite not excelling immediately, Park persisted and gradually found his footing in the game.
Acknowledging the dominance of private schools in the field of hockey, Park emphasized the challenges faced by state schools due to limited resources and facilities. He expressed hope that his journey would inspire others from similar backgrounds to explore field hockey and seize opportunities that come their way. Park’s inclusion in the GB programme post-Tokyo Olympics marked a turning point in his career, as he adjusted to the heightened pace and intensity of international play.
Recalling his early experiences in the Pro League, Park remarked, “My first Pro League game, I was like, ‘wow, this is the real deal'”. Over the past three years, Park has honed his skills and earned a spot on the Olympic team, a testament to his dedication and growth in the sport. Under the guidance of head coach Paul Revington, the team has embraced an attacking style of play, leading England to the finals of the EuroHockey Championships.
Park’s strengths lie in his physicality and ability to adapt to the demanding nature of the game. “I am someone who likes to run, I’ve always been physically demanding on myself and hopefully that brings people with me,” shared Park. His development in defensive skills has been a focal point in his recent progression, showcasing his versatility on the field.
